Tom Brady has long been admired not only by fans for his play on the football field, but by fans who enjoy his good looks.
Brady’s likeness was creating some creepy reverberations across the internet on Monday, a day after the New England Patriots posted a 23-21 victory over the Arizona Cardinals.
The Pro Bowl and likely future Hall of Fame quarterback on Sunday was serving the first of a four-game suspension imposed by the NFL for his participation in the Deflategate scandal.
But a man who showed up at the Patriots-Cardinals game at the University of Phoenix Stadium wearing a detailed Tom Brady mask turned a lot of heads before getting his “face” plastered across the internet.
According to a Tweet posted by Bleacher Report, the man, who was seen on the video wearing a No. 12 Patriots T-shirt with “VACAYTRIOTS” on the front and #FAKEBRADY on the back, hung out with tailgaters and participated in some pregame activities outside the stadium.
The video had received more than 1,000 re-tweets on Twitter as of Monday afternoon.
New England did not seem to miss the real Brady on Sunday night as backup quarterback Jimmy Garoppolo directed the team to victory.
